Hello all.
My name's Ben, I'm out of El Paso, TX, and I just started a project based on a '76 K5. Currently, it's sitting on 32" BFG AT KO's and running a SB 400 into a TH350, a Dana 44 front, and a 10 bolt in the rear. I just purchased a '83 3/4 ton long bed to be an axle and T case donor (NP205). I'll post pics ASAP and keep you updated on the progress.
Thanks!
